

George was born on May 12, 1945 in Blount County Alabama. He graduated from Lakeland Senior High School in 1963 and joined the Air Force where he proudly served for six years. After the Air Force, he worked for Seaboard Coast Line Railroad, later CSX Railroad, for 32 years.
He was a constant fixer, tinkerer, and builder of all things. If it was broken, he could fix it. From cars to sinks to tools, George could either build it or he could fix it. He spent his time doing this not only because he enjoyed it, but because it was how he helped others. Helping friends, neighbors and family is what brought him joy.
He was preceded in death by his father, Glen Holmes; his mother, Ruth Holmes; his biological father, R.C. Thompson; his sister, Sharon Mangum and his aunt, Jean Holmes. He is survived by Mary Thompson, his wife of 31 years; his children, Jeremy Thompson (Jill), Amanda Gore (Garrett) and Cassandra Malbasic; his sister, Sallie Whited (Tommy); two nieces, two nephews, and three granddaughters.
